S
PECIFICATION OF INTENDED USE
 Anchorages subject to:
Static and quasi-static loading: rebar size ϕ 8 to ϕ 32 mm.
-
 Base material
-
Compacted reinforced or unreinforced normal weight concrete without fibres according to EN 206:2013+A1:2016.
-
Strength classes C20/25 to C50/60 according to EN 206:2013+A1:2016.
-
Maximum chloride content of 0,40 % (CL 0.40) related to the cement content according to EN 206:2013+A1:2016.
-
Non-carbonated concrete
Note: In case of a carbonated surface of the existing concrete structure the carbonated layer shall be removed in the area of the
post-installed rebar connection with a diameter of ϕ + 60 mm prior to the installation of the new rebar. The depth of concrete to
be removed shall correspond at least to the minimum concrete cover in accordance with EN 1992-1-1. The foregoing may be
neglected if building components are new and not carbonated and if building components are in dry conditions.
 Temperature in the base material
-
At installation:
-10 °C to +40 °C
-
In service
Temperature range I: -40 °C to +40 °C
Temperature range II: -40 °C to +80 °C
Temperature range III: -40 °C to +120 °C
 Design
-
Anchorages are designed under the responsibility of an engineer experienced in anchorages and concrete work.
-
Verifiable calculation notes and drawings are prepared taking account of the forces to be transmitted.
-
Design under static or quasi-static loading in accordance with EOTA TR 069.
-
The actual position of the reinforcement in the existing structure shall be determined on the basis of the
construction documentation and taken into account when designing.
 Installation
-
Use category: dry or wet concrete (not in flooded holes).
-
Drilling technique: hammer drilling (HD), hammer drilling with Hilti hollow drill bit TE-CD, TE-YD (HDB), or
diamond coring with roughening with Hilti roughening tool TE-YRT (RT).
-
Overhead installation is admissible.
-
Rebar installation carried out by appropriately qualified personnel and under the supervision of the person
responsible for technical matters of the site.
Check the position of the existing rebars (if the position of existing rebars is not known, it shall be determined
using a rebar detector suitable for this purpose as well as on the basis of the construction documentation and
then marked on the building component).
